The Aubrey Park Hotel is set in woodlands a short drive from Hemel Hempstead and St Albans, being only 8 miles from Luton Airport, 5 minutes' drive from junction 9 of the M1 and 10 minutes' drive from the M25. Ample free parking and a cocktail bar with 3D TV is also on offer. Free Wi-Fi, a 32-inch flat-screen TV and an en suite bathroom with luxury toiletries are featured in each room at Aubrey Park. The on-site brasserie restaurant features dishes made with locally sourced produce. A traditional English breakfast is also on offer, as well as a variety of continental options. Attractions close to the hotel include Harry Potter Studio Tours, Hertfordshire Show Grounds, Historic St.Albans, Whipsnade Zoo, Woburn Safari Park and Hemel Hempstead Snow Center.
